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

The invention relates to a hydraulic axial piston machine ( 1 ) of dry case type of construction, whose case ( 2 ) is provided for connection to a gearing case ( 21 ) so as to form a fluid-tight overall case. The case ( 2 ) has openings ( 10 ) which permit the passage of leakage hydraulic fluid or of lubricant into the gearing case ( 21 ). By means of this design, splashing losses of the axial piston machine ( 1 ) are eliminated, and the leakage hydraulic fluid or the lubricant serve for the lubrication both of the axial piston machine ( 1 ) and of the gearing ( 20 ).

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ed: 1. Hydraulic axial piston machine ( 1 ) of dry case type of construction, having a case ( 2 ) for accommodating a drive assembly ( 4 ) which can be adjusted by means of an adjustment device ( 3 ) and which serves for delivering hydraulic liquid, and having a drive shaft ( 5 ) which is operatively connected to the drive assembly ( 4 ) and which is mounted in the case ( 2 ) by means of bearings ( 6 , 7 ) so as to be rotatable about its longitudinal axis ( 8 ), wherein neither the drive assembly ( 4 ), the drive shaft ( 5 ) nor the bearings ( 6 , 7 ) thereof run in a sump ( 9 ) of the hydraulic liquid, and the case ( 2 ) has openings ( 10 ), via which leakage hydraulic liquid and lubricant can flow out of the case ( 2 ), and a fastening flange ( 11 ), which is arranged, transversely with respect to the longitudinal axis ( 8 ) of the drive shaft ( 5 ), between the adjustment device ( 3 ) of the axial piston machine ( 1 ) and the openings ( 10 ) in the case ( 2 ). 2. Axial piston machine according to claim 1 , having a first bearing region ( 12 ) and a second bearing region ( 13 ) which are provided on the drive shaft ( 5 ) for the purpose of accommodating rolling or plain bearings, and having a drive input/output region ( 14 ) which is arranged on the drive shaft ( 5 ), for the purposes of driving or extracting power from the drive shaft ( 5 ), wherein the first bearing region ( 12 ) is arranged within the case ( 2 ). 3. Axial piston machine according to claim 2 , in which the drive input/output region ( 14 ) is arranged between the first bearing region ( 12 ) and the second bearing region ( 13 ). 4. Axial piston machine according to claim 2 , in which the second bearing region ( 13 ) is arranged between the first bearing region ( 12 ) and the drive input/output region ( 14 ). 5. Axial piston machine according to claim 2 , in which the second bearing region ( 13 ) and/or the drive input/output region ( 14 ) are arranged outside the case ( 2 ). 6. Axial piston machine according to claim 1 , in which, in the installed state of the axial piston machine ( 1 ), the openings ( 10 ) in the case ( 2 ) are arranged at the lowest point of the case ( 2 ). 7. Axial piston machine according claim 1 , in which the fastening flange ( 11 ) is equipped with sealing means ( 15 ). 8. Axial piston machine according to claim 2 , in which a tapered-roller bearing is provided at the first bearing region ( 12 ) for the mounting of the drive shaft ( 5 ) in the case ( 2 ) of the axial piston machine ( 1 ). 9. Axial piston machine according to claim 2 , in which an inner ring ( 16 ) of a rolling or plain bearing is arranged in the second bearing region ( 13 ) of the drive shaft ( 5 ). 10. Axial piston machine according to claim 1 , in which lubricant ducts ( 17 ) are formed at least partially by a central bore ( 18 ) arranged in the drive shaft ( 5 ) and by transverse bores ( 19 ) which intersect the central bore ( 18 ). 11. Hydraulic drive having an axial piston machine ( 1 ) according to claim 1 and having a gearing ( 20 ) with a gearing case ( 21 ) onto which the case ( 2 ) of the axial piston machine ( 1 ) is flange-mounted such that the two cases ( 2 , 21 ) together surround an interior space which is sealed in fluid-tight fashion to the outside, a gearwheel ( 22 ) of the gearing ( 20 ) engages into the drive input/output region ( 14 ) of the drive shaft ( 5 ) of the axial piston machine ( 1 ), and the openings ( 10 ) in the case ( 2 ) of the axial piston machine ( 1 ) are arranged such that leakage hydraulic liquid and/or lubricant can flow into the gearing case ( 21 ). 12. Hydraulic drive having an axial piston machine ( 1 ) according to claim 1 , in which, in a gearing case ( 21 ), there is provided a bearing receiving region ( 23 ) for accommodating a second bearing region ( 13 ) of the drive shaft ( 5 ) of the axial piston machine ( 1 ). 13. Hydraulic drive according to claim 12 , in which a floating bearing for the mounting of the drive shaft ( 5 ) is designed for receiving the second bearing region ( 13 ). 14. Hydraulic drive according to claim 11 , characterized in that pump means are provided for removing leakage hydraulic liquid and/or lubricant from the gearing case ( 21 ).
